Output 52e02bc5091ee4ff2bb4d7f00921d2513b4887c10a28a6c6eb893070d78d0637:2

value
143440000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8bf13ed3ae307098002908975609b5e400b8bc51 OP_EQUAL
address
3ESxrEWF2UKd8SZR7m4Z2cKPDQn3oJWiCY
transaction
52e02bc5091ee4ff2bb4d7f00921d2513b4887c10a28a6c6eb893070d78d0637
spent
true